Bruce By-election, 14th April, 1920.

RETURN showing the Number of Votes recorded for each Candidate at the Bruce By-election, 14th April, 1920; the Number of Informal Votes; the Number of Electors who did not vote; the Number of Electors on the Roll; the Percentage of Votes recorded for Candidate elected (a) to the Total Number of Electors on the Roll, and (b) to the Total Valid Votes recorded.

Candidates. Number of Votes recorded. Number of Electors who did not vote. Number of Electors on Roll. Percentage of Votes recorded for Candidate elected
For each Candidate. Informal Votes. Total. (a) To Total Number of Electors on Roll.
Edie, John .. 2,421 .. .. ..
Begg, James .. 2,297 16 4,734 2,672

Men on roll .. .. .. .. .. .. 3,945
Women on roll .. .. .. .. .. .. 3,461

Total .. .. .. .. .. .. 7,406

Proportion per cent. of men and women on the roll .. Men, 53; women, 47
Men who voted .. .. .. .. .. .. 2,582
Women who voted .. .. .. .. .. .. 2,152

Total .. .. .. .. .. .. 4,734

Proportion per cent. of votes recorded by men and women respectively to the total number of votes recorded .. Men, 55; women, 45
Percentage of votes recorded by men and women respectively to the total number of men and women on the roll .. .. .. Men, 65·45; women, 62·18
Percentage of the total number of votes recorded to the total number of electors on the roll .. .. .. .. 63·92
Percentage of informal votes recorded .. .. .. .. 0·34

Notice to Mariners.—No. 46 of 1920.

AUCKLAND HARBOUR.—DREDGING.

Marine Department,
Wellington, N.Z., 3rd August, 1920.

NOTICE is hereby given that suction dredge No. 2 is moored 156° (S. 39¼ E. magnetic) 1,350 ft. from the light-tower on King’s Wharf, and has six moorings laid out in north, south, east, and west directions.

A line of pipes moored on punts extends approximately 400 ft. to the westward of the dredger, thence to the southward to the new reclamation wall.

Charts, &c., affected.—Admiralty Chart No. 1970; “New Zealand Nautical Almanac,” 1920, page 259.
